Ingredients
Scale
- 1 bag (10 oz) Doritos (Nacho Cheese flavor recommended)
- 1 cup mozzarella cheese, cubed
- 1/2 cup all-purpose flour
- 2 large eggs
- 1 cup seasoned breadcrumbs (or panko)
- 2 cups vegetable oil (for frying)
Instructions
- Gather all ingredients and set them on your counter.
- Heat oil in a deep skillet over medium-high heat until shimmering (about 350°F).
- Prepare cheese by cutting it into 1-inch cubes.
- Set up a breading station: one bowl with flour, one with whisked eggs, and one with breadcrumbs.
- Gently open each Dorito on one side, stuff with cheese, and press closed.
- Dip each stuffed Dorito in flour, then egg wash, and finally coat in breadcrumbs.
- Fry in hot oil until golden brown (about 2-3 minutes per side).
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 10 minutes
